原创 優秀網關應該具備的功能
基礎功能: 1 路由轉發 路由轉發是網關最最基礎的功能,沒有之一,一個不具備轉發功能的網關不具備任何使用價值。轉發功能的優劣取決於轉發策略的豐富度,常用的轉發策略有基於host轉發、path轉發、加權輪詢、根據自己業務場景在reque
原创 YAPI生產規格安裝文檔
目錄 序言:爲什麼需要API管理工具 1 並行開發 2 Demo快速搭建: 3 自動化測試 4 API文檔庫 1 安裝yarn 2 安裝mongodb 3 安裝yapi 4 數據庫配置鑑權認證 5 啓動yapi服務 6 ngin
原创 Spinnaker第五節-金絲雀分析
目錄 核心思想: 金絲雀分析的意義: 三大分區: 載體區: 監控區: Spinnaker區: 載體區的原理圖: 監控區的原理圖 Spinnaker區的原理圖: 三大區總體圖: 思考題: Spinnaker的金絲雀分析並不是Spinnake
原创 2019雲棲大會歸來有感
剛從杭州雲棲大會回來,今天在CSDN博客中跟小夥伴們分享下大會的內容和我自己的一些見解。 今年這是第十界雲棲大會了,命名爲APSARA,翻譯過來是“飛天”,從這個擡頭就可以看出阿里的野心,不過他們確實有“一飛沖天”的資本,因爲他們在
原创 覆盤AutoX微服務技術選型
前言: 去年12月份寫過一篇博文《從一個簡單需求學習微服務思想》,當時接到了一個需求任務要把企業內部運維棧和工具棧的系統全部管理起來,出於功能和性能擴展維度的考慮,選擇用SpringCloud微服務架構來開發,命名爲AutoX,到現在已經
原创 Spinnaker第三節-對接雲實例
目錄 前言: Infrastructure與實例雲對應關係 Spinnaker的Bake階段 Spinnaker的金絲雀分析 持續集成全流程設計: 部署策略 雲平臺差異性 注意事項: 1 伸縮規則的繼承 2 線上服務不可中斷 3 按量計
原创 Spinnaker第六節-開發和使用細節
今年在原版spinnaker的基礎上我們和雲平臺廠商合作支持了阿里雲和騰訊雲,俗話說“是騾子是馬拉出來遛遛“,今年的跨年晚會彈性部分將完全交給spinnaker來處理。現在是聖誕夜,我和小夥伴們還在spinnaker平臺上加班做容災和擴容
原创 Spinnaker第七節—Orca代碼詳解
這個春節假期由於新冠弄得一直在家憋着,閒得無事把spinnaker代碼翻出來把每個微服務重新review一遍,做了一些筆記,今天拿來分享一下,後續如果有spinnaker開發或者bug修復可以直接有的放矢。計劃先把核心的幾個微服務分幾期慢
原创 Spring Cloud Gateway VS Netflix Zuul2
最近公司要引入統一網關,自己也參與調研了幾種,當在研究Netflix的Zuul2和SpringCloudGateway時被網絡上雜七雜八的材料跟震驚了,不客氣地說很多國內博客都是在誤人子弟,充斥着那些基於SpringCloud全家桶號稱自
原创 Spinnaker第九節—CloudDriver代碼詳解
CloudDriver遵循NetflixSpinnaker家族標準的代碼目錄結構: Clouddriver-web是主入口和公共controller,clouddriver-core是抽象和默認實現,clouddriver-XXX是雲廠商
原创 Lucene結構分析
如圖是Lucene生成索引的一個實例,主要分爲以下幾個層次: 索引(Index): 一個索引實例就是一個文件夾,該文件夾中所有文件都屬於同一個索引。 段(Segment): 一個索引包含1~N個段,段與段之間是獨立的,添加新文檔可以
原创 雲架構師知識圖譜
如何成爲一個合格的雲架構師,至少需要先掌握圖譜中出現的所有知識點。 後期會專門開幾個專題,針對每一支圖譜進行系統講解,講透他們的原理、使用方式和應用場景。
原创 Spinnaker產品說明
目錄 1 產品簡介 2 架構設計 2.1 生命週期 2.2 功能架構 2.3 發佈流程 2.4 微服務技術架構 3 Spinnaker的優勢 3.1 支持多雲 3.2 多種發佈策略 3.2.1 無策略 3.2.2 Highla
原创 敏感信息監控通用方案
背景: 春節過後公司有個核心部門遭到競爭對手的強力挖角,所謂鐵打的營盤流水的兵,人員的流失並不可怕,公司擔心的是wiki這類的文檔中心裏的設計、方案、策劃等核心資料外泄。所以必須要加強文檔庫敏感操作的監控,及時止損。 分析:
原创 容器知識瞭解平行宇宙
平行宇宙,這個科幻片電影中最常引用的概念;容器,這個雲原生時代最常提到的技術。這倆本是八竿子打不到一起的東西,今天,我就嘗試用容器知識體系來幫助大家理解下平行世界。 正常人理解到三維沒有任何困難,就是我們看到的xyz立體空